&lt;p&gt;The victim of a beating captured on videotape outside the West Bank city of Hebron has spoken about the day he was set upon by Jewish settlers.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Midhat Abu Karsh, a 30-year-old Palestinian teacher was beaten for allegedly setting fire to fields in the area.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Nour Odeh reports on how he and human rights groups are fighting back.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Are we now living in an era that echoes the 1960s? Comparisons between the wars in Iraq and Vietnam have become commonplace rhetorical devices in political campaigns, newspaper columns, and stand-up comedy routines. These comparisons can be illustrative, illuminating, and even funny, but are they apt?&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;In conversation with Grace Cathedral's Dean, Alan Jones, U.C. Berkeley professor of history Kathleen Frydl will discuss the cultural features - the rise of the mass media, fluctuations in American knowledge and public opinion, the level of public trust in government - of the Vietnam Era against the backdrop of the intervening 40 years and today's zeitgeist.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Kathleen Frydl's field is the U.S. since 1607, with special emphasis on the 20th century. Thus far her research has focused on political history and, within that subfield, she has maintained a particular interest in institutions. She lectures survey courses on recent U.S. history, political history from the Gilded Age, and (with her colleague Peter Zinoman) on the Vietnam War.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The short video mashup above (3:10) is from Saturday's peace march in Los Angeles sponsored by A.N.S.W.E.R. LA to mark the 5th anniversary of the Iraq invasion. The rally was different from others that I've attended since the Iraq occupation began in that it was dominated by young people and because I never once saw a camera crew or truck from the mainstream media.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;While the mainstream media rarely report more than a sound bite of one of the crazier or scarier people in attendance at these rallies, at least they previously had the courtesy of pretending to take seriously the majority of Americans who remain anti-war. Apparently this is no longer the case.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Meanwhile, one would have hoped that after five years of horrific war - that has cost nearly 4,000 American lives and hundreds of thousands of Iraqi lives - more than a few thousand people would rally for peace in a city of 10 million. Soon we will be able to add our democracy to the list of the dead.&lt;/p&gt;
